A festival of joy, wonder and magic in the heart of the city.

This festive season, Fed Square becomes Melbourne’s Festive Headquarters – we’re sprinkling the magic dust to bring you an inclusive celebration of all that makes this most wonderful time of the year all warm and glowy-special.

We’ll play host to big festive-season names, like Koorie Klaus, Santa Claus and the marvellous Huxleys; we’re screening some classic films; we’ve got giveaways and festive workshops and caroling choirs galore; Christmas in the Wizarding World is back for witches, wizards and muggles alike – and we’re thrilled to bring you the annual celebration of Chunukah, Pillars of Light, over six hope and light-filled evenings.

And of course, Fed Square will be lit up, all starlight-starbright, looking glittery and gorge, as we’re once again the home of Christmas Square – with the city’s stunning 16metre-high twinkling tree as our centrepiece.

It’s a Wonderful Life Screening

Sunday 27 November, 3pm | Big Screen

Enjoy free popcorn and bring the family (and tissues) to enjoy this Christmas classic film, widely considered one of the greatest films of all time, featuring James Stewart. When frustrated businessman, George Bailey (Stewart), questions the meaning and value of his life, his guardian angel is sent to him. The angel reveals to Bailey how the lives of those he loves most would have turned out, if he had never existed.
